A preliminary study on the influence of obstructive sleep apnea upon cumulative parasympathetic system activity.

Abstract

OBJECTIVE

Although the autonomic nervous system plays a key role in mediating cardiovascular changes during obstructive sleep apnea (OSA), parasympathetic nervous system (PNS) activity during sleep apnea has not yet been sufficiently investigated. This study is to discuss the relationship between PNS activity and OSA.

METHODS

Polysomnography recording was carried out in 76 patients (71 male and 5 female) with OSA. Cumulative PNS activity during sleep for each patient was derived from time series data of electrocardiogram (ECG) and analyzed by coarse graining spectral analysis of heart rate variability. The correlation between cumulative PNS activity and apnea-hypopnea index (AHI) was then discussed.

RESULTS

Cumulative PNS activity and PNS peaks during sleep were lowly but significantly correlated with OSA severity (r=-0.344, p<0.005; and r=-0.266, p<0.05 respectively), and a linear regression equation could be established. Furthermore, significant correlation was also observed in the adult groups and in the moderate and severe groups, but not in the juvenile and the elderly and mild groups.

CONCLUSION

These findings indicated that PNS function was obviously influenced by OSA during sleep. Cumulative PNS activity level might also serve as a useful parameter for the evaluation of OSA.

摘要

目的

尽管自主神经系统在阻塞性睡眠呼吸暂停(OSA)期间介导心血管变化中起关键作用,但睡眠呼吸暂停期间副交感神经系统(PNS)的活动尚未得到充分研究。本研究旨在探讨PNS活动与OSA之间的关系。

方法

对76例OSA患者(71例男性,5例女性)进行多导睡眠图记录。每位患者睡眠期间的累积PNS活动来自心电图(ECG)的时间序列数据,并通过心率变异性的粗粒化频谱分析进行分析。然后讨论累积PNS活动与呼吸暂停低通气指数(AHI)之间的相关性。

结果

睡眠期间的累积PNS活动和PNS峰值与OSA严重程度呈低度但显著相关(分别为r = -0.344,p < 0.005;r = -0.266,p < 0.05),并且可以建立线性回归方程。此外,在成年组以及中度和重度组中也观察到显著相关性,但在青少年、老年人和轻度组中未观察到。

结论

这些发现表明睡眠期间PNS功能明显受OSA影响。累积PNS活动水平也可能作为评估OSA的有用参数。
